Hi friends, today is my day to post on the Jaded Blossom Blog, and I have a soft and pretty spring birthday card to share with you.


I started this card with the gorgeous new Tulips layering set. I stamped the outline of the tulip with stem and the leaf in black ink, then stamped the highlight portion for the flower and leaf in a fadeout no line watercolor ink.  I then used those faint lines to go in with copic markers in my darkest shades and add the shadows, then blend out the rest of the image with lighter shades. I then cut with the coordinating Tulips Outline Dies and assembled together.


I don't know about you, but sometimes I get stuck in a reality rut, thinking things need to be their actual color... especially with stencils. Here I started with the idea of traditional orange carrots as a background, but then decided to give a tone on tone look a try and I love the way it turned out! So here I stenciled the Carrot Stencil with the same color ink as the cardstock, then added the carrot tops with a light green ink for a soft and subtle background,. This allows my tulip image to take center stage on the card. The sentiment is from the Hello Beautiful stamp set (I just LOVE these gorgeous sentiments) and embossed in white onto a Stitched Oval Die cut. I then matted with a vellum die cut with the Scallop Oval Dies and accented the scallops with some nuvo drops.  I finished off with the Card Mat Dies for a finished edge on my background panel.
